Voicemail Number s Message Recording Tips and hints
The voicemail number can be acquired by everybody, but nobody seems to be making great
use of it.
Try calling a friend who happens to have his or her hand phone switched off, and you’ll
be sent straight to an automatic voicemail recording.
You’ll hear “Hi, I cannot get to the
telephone as of a moment.
Please leave a note and I’ll respond as soon as possible.
”
This could possibly work for a personal number.
But your recording need to sound much better
than that if it s for enterprise voicemail systems.
The voice greetings of the voicemail number need to ideally have the caller think that they’re not
speaking with a machine.
They must feel that the call is valuable, and that you will absolutely
regret not being able to answer the phone call.
When a caller hangs up the call, they must feel
happy that they called you, and not let down for not being in a position to talk with everyone.
Be certain that you re in a quiet background
